mirror of https://github.com/python/cpython
get rid of assert (size >= 0) now that an explicit if (size < 0) is in the code.
This commit is contained in:
parent
36a59b4a08
commit
2ea2968064
|
@ -160,7 +160,6 @@ PyBytes_FromStringAndSize(const char *bytes, Py_ssize_t size)
|
|||
PyBytesObject *new;
|
||||
Py_ssize_t alloc;
|
||||
|
||||
assert(size >= 0);
|
||||
if (size < 0) {
|
||||
PyErr_SetString(PyExc_SystemError,
|
||||
"Negative size passed to PyBytes_FromStringAndSize");
|
||||
|
|
|
@ -55,7 +55,6 @@ PyObject *
|
|||
PyString_FromStringAndSize(const char *str, Py_ssize_t size)
|
||||
{
|
||||
register PyStringObject *op;
|
||||
assert(size >= 0);
|
||||
if (size < 0) {
|
||||
PyErr_SetString(PyExc_SystemError,
|
||||
"Negative size passed to PyString_FromStringAndSize");
|
||||
|
|
|
@ -466,7 +466,6 @@ PyObject *PyUnicode_FromStringAndSize(const char *u, Py_ssize_t size)
|
|||
{
|
||||
PyUnicodeObject *unicode;
|
||||
|
||||
assert(size <= 0);
|
||||
if (size < 0) {
|
||||
PyErr_SetString(PyExc_SystemError,
|
||||
"Negative size passed to PyUnicode_FromStringAndSize");
|
||||
|
|
Loading…
Reference in New Issue